I have a feeling that many of us are about to look back fondly on offices and their free heating as we pull on another pair of socks.A post shared by BRORA (@broracashmere) on Oct 19, 2020 at 9:59am PDTThe trick is to cultivate a set of clever layering pieces with which to winterise under-insulated outfits.

Uniqlo rules this area with its Heattech line, but last winter I turned to Marks & Spencer’s Heatgen – its polo-neck thermal bodysuit is a dead ringer for Wolford, and a sleek way to warm up silk dresses.Arket’s contribution to the genre is a sheer roll-neck..
